uclibrary's read books


Expand filter menu Filter list (356 books)

356 books

288 pages2025 10 editions

fiction literary science fiction mysterious reflective medium-paced

320 pages2023 69 editions

fiction crime mystery thriller adventurous funny mysterious fast-paced

215 pages2024 5 editions

fiction literary challenging emotional reflective medium-paced

235 pages2021 93 editions

fiction fantasy historical lgbtqia+ romance dark emotional tense medium-paced

208 pages2023 9 editions

fiction fantasy adventurous dark emotional fast-paced

146 pages2024 6 editions

fiction fantasy adventurous emotional fast-paced

146 pages2025 6 editions

fiction fantasy adventurous emotional fast-paced

416 pages2016 91 editions

fiction science fiction thriller dark mysterious tense fast-paced

355 pages2019 195 editions

fiction historical literary emotional reflective medium-paced

132 pages2023 4 editions

fiction contemporary graphic novel emotional hopeful inspiring fast-paced